TRM’s Jones heading to UWA

Published 6:00 am Wednesday, August 12, 2015

Former T.R. Miller Tiger Chris Jones is fulfilling a dream.
That is how the recent TRM graduate described the feeling of having working for a chance to walk on and play football at the University of West Alabama football team in Livingston.
“I am grateful that I am able to fulfill the dream I’ve had since I was in elementary school,” Jones said. “UWA is competitive, close to home and seemed to be a good fit for me. Also, one of my best friends is also there.”
That friend Jones talked about is another former Tiger of TRM as Terry Samuel will also be at UWA. Samuel signed with UWA on National Signing Day in February.
“It is extremely great to be able to play on the same team with Terry and against former TRM players like Keion (Smith), Kam (Coleman), and Mac (Coleman),” Jones said.
Jones, who will be playing defensive end and defensive tackle, said he hopes to earn his teaching degree and wants to one day be able to coach others.
“I also hope to be an impact player for the team in the future,” he said. “I hope that after this season I should be able to earn a scholarship.
“I am looking forward to playing hard, making an impact and finding a spot on the scholarship roster.”
Jones said he turned down offers from Capital in Ohio, Mount St. Joseph in Ohio and most recently, Kentucky Christ University.
“I though it would be better to try to stay closer to home and be able to play with a former team mate and make my former Coach Riggs proud,” Jones said.
Jones is the son of Tracy Jones.
